Sermon Outline:


  1. Towers of the World (世界之高塔)

A tower is a symbol of power, pride and prestige. It marks the achievement of the city that builds it. It gives recognition, a name, to those who live around it. It shouts out to the world, on behalf of its builders, ‘Here we are! We have made it!’

Eiffel Tower was built in 1887 at the height of 318m. Interestingly enough, it was hated by the Parisians when it was built, and it was almost torn down in 1909. Now the tower symbolizes Paris and has become a very popular destination for visitors.

Empire State Building was built in 1931at the height of 443m. It was constructed during the golden era of 1920s in New York that was characterized by wealth, greed, and excesses. Ironically, when the building was officially opened during the Great Depression, many of its office space sat empty for years following.

CN Tower was completed in 1973 at the height of 553m. The original project was designed to be a TV and radio communication tower of only 300m. But during the 60’s and the 70’s, Toronto was booming. New skyscrapers were popping up around the city. In order to keep up, CN Tower was redesigned to its current height. It was the tallest free-standing structure in the world for the next 34 years, and in 1995, it was declared as one of the seven modern wonders of the world.

  1. The Tower of Babel (巴別塔)

The story of the tower of Babel was recorded in chapter 11 of Genesis. It was told in a way that sets the will of mankind against the will of God. The story began with the world having one language (v.1), and it ends with the LORD confusing the language of the whole world (v.9). In-between, the story was written in a chiastic structure where the action and intention of mankind was recorded in v.2-4, and the corresponding intention and action of God was recorded in v.6-8.

The action of mankind began with movement eastward. The Hebrew word that was used for ‘moving’ is the same word as ‘journeying’ for Abram, and ‘wandering’ for the Israelites during the Exodus. It conveys a sense of unknown, danger, and perhaps growth. The eastward direction is the same direction where Adam and Eve were kicked out of Eden. It reminds us of the previous judgment that God had cast on humanity.

They eventually ‘settled there’ (v.2) in the plain of Shinar, also known as the land Babylon. The corresponding opposite of this action is in verse 8 where God ‘scattered them from there’ to all over the world.

In verse 3, they said to each other, ‘Come, let us make bricks.’ Using brick and mortar for building materials (instead of stone and mud) was a great technological advancement in its time. It allows structures to be built much higher, in much more stable way. The corresponding opposite of this action can be found in verse 7 where God said, ‘Come, let us go down and confuse their language’.

The intention of mankind was to build a city and a tower that reaches to heaven (v.4). The explicit reason was to ‘make a name for themselves’, so that they would not be ‘scattered over the face of the earth’. The implicit reason of building a tower that reaches into heaven was to compete against God, to be like God. It was the same reason that Adam and Eve took the fruit from the tree of knowledge in the Garden of Eden (Genesis 3:5).

The corresponding opposite of mankind’s intention can be found in verse 6 where God’s intention was made clear. God did not want mankind to plan things for themselves against God’s own plan. Only God can plan without limit. Man is not supposed to emulate his creator in this way.

The central point of the chiastic structure of verse 1-9, thus the focal point of this story, can be found in verse 5 – ‘the LORD came down!’ With heavy irony we now see the tower through God’s eyes. This tower which man thought reached to heaven, God can hardly see! From the height of heaven it seems so insignificant that the LORD must come down to look at it! It is simply a brilliant and dramatic way of expressing the puniness of man’s greatest achievements, when set alongside the creator’s omnipotence.’

  1. Leaving Babel Behind (離開巴別塔)

The word ‘Babel’ closely resembles the Hebrew word ‘balel’, which means ‘to be confused’. The story of the tower of Babel serves as a reminder to us not to be confused of our place, our role, and our limitation. It reminds us of the consequences of going against the will of God. It reminds us that we are not God, and we can never be ‘like God’.

The story of Babel in chapter 11 of Genesis is followed by the story call of Abram in chapter 12. In that story, Abram was asked by God to leave his country and his people in the land of Ur, which is located in the same region as Babel. In the same way we are also asked by God to leave our Babel behind. Leave Babel behind so God’s plan of salvation can begin through us, as it was through Abraham.
